*{font-family:Trebuchet MS,Lucida Sans Unicode,Lucida Grande,Lucida Sans,Arial,sans-serif;margin:0;padding:0}.ondaBottom,.ondaTop{background-image:url(https://cdn.acs.art.br/acs%2Festrutura%2Fonda.png)}.ondaTop{top:-25px;height:120px;transform:rotatex(180deg)}.ondaBottom,.ondaTop{display:block;position:absolute;left:0;width:100%;background-repeat:no-repeat;background-size:cover}.ondaBottom{bottom:-7px;height:100px;transform:rotateY(180deg)}.logoFooter{animation:FooterLogo 50s ease-in-out infinite}@keyframes FooterLogo{0%{transform:translate(0);rotate:0deg}20%{transform:translate(-10px,-15px);rotate:-3deg}40%{transform:translate(5px,15px);rotate:3deg}60%{transform:translate(-5px,15px);rotate:-3deg}80%{transform:translate(5px,-15px);rotate:3deg}to{transform:translate(0);rotate:0degg}}@media screen and (max-width:576px){.ondaTop{top:-30px}.ondaBottom,.ondaTop{height:100px;background-repeat:no-repeat}.ondaBottom{bottom:-9px}}@media screen and (min-width:577px) and (max-width:767px){.ondaTop{top:-30px}.ondaBottom,.ondaTop{height:100px;background-repeat:no-repeat}.ondaBottom{bottom:-9px}}@media screen and (min-width:768px) and (max-width:991px){.ondaTop{top:-2px;height:100px}.ondaBottom{bottom:-9px;height:110px}}@media screen and (min-width:1200px) and (max-width:1399px){.ondaTop{top:-26px;height:130px}.ondaBottom{bottom:-9px;height:110px}}@media screen and (min-width:1400px) and (max-width:1699px){.ondaTop{top:-15px;height:130px}.ondaBottom{bottom:-6px;height:130px}}@media screen and (min-width:1700px){.ondaTop{top:-2px;height:140px}.ondaBottom{bottom:0;height:140px}}